A level roof gets about 1,000 watts of sunlight per square meter in the midday sun. Roll roof covering, that is usually black, will soak up the majority of the energy from the sun, warming the roofing system along with structure. Any kind of sort of roll roof can offer solar reflectance. The black membranes can be coated with white paint to make them reflective. A tidy, white roof mirrors around 85% of the sunlight as well as can substantially reduce power.

Tar paper is a heavy-duty paper used in construction. Tar paper is distinguished from roofing felt which is impregnated with asphalt instead of tar; but these two products are used the same way, and their names sometimes are used informally as synonyms. Tar paper has been in use for centuries.

Cut the second item of roll roof covering the size of the roofing system. A common roofing has 3 layers-- a felt layer as well as 2 layers of overlapping tiles. It has simply one layer, so it goes on rapid and can be mounted by a home owner with fundamental Do It Yourself experience and devices. It is mainly utilized for garages and sheds that have a low-slope roof covering. Roll roofing can be found in a selection of shades to match existing roof covering on the residential property.
Rolled roofing, by comparison, is available in lighter 75-pound systems and is firmly rolled up and also secured. Expert contractors usually have cranes or forklifts relocate traditional roof shingles from the ground to roofing degree. If you are a do-it-yourselfer, you can relocate the rolls to the roof covering on your own or with the help of a companion, no machinery called for. Unlike shingles, which use individually, you can roll out a square of mineral surface rolled roofing within mins.
